Magli "Mollie" Hansen Kirkvold
(Sep 1859 - 3 May 1941)
Singsåsboka Bind II page 204-205: "Magli born 1859 moved to America in 1882, together with her ??daughter Serina, b. 1880 Father: Sven Svensen Hermo, Nordstu'u, who traveled to America in 1880."
She ended up going to Yankton with her sister Siri and she later moved to White Lake, SD where she married Andrew Nelson in 1886. she was born Sept. 2, 1859 and died May 3, 1941. She spent a lot of time in Hendricks.She is and her family are double-listed in the 1910 census. She appears once as Mollie Nelson and the other time as Molly Nelson.

Funeral Service Held for Pioneer Bovee Resident
June 26, 1941
Male Kjerkvold Nelson, an old time resident of the Bovee Com-following a long illness. She died at the Sunny Side Old Folks Home at Sioux Falls at the age of 81 years, 9 months, and 17 days.
Funeral services were held at the Frankes Lutheran Church of Bloomington, and were conducted by Rev. Thermo and by student pastor, Lutherd Eid. She was carried to her final resting place by her six nephews, Johnny, Justin, and Almer Forseth; Elmer, Arthur, and Leland Arnsten.
Interment took place in the Frankes Lutheran cemetery where she was laid to rest in the family lot beside her husband.
Male Kjerkvold was born at Singsaas, Norway, on Sept. 1, 1859,. She came to America with her parents in 1882 and settled in Minnesota.
In 1885 she was united in marriage to Andrew Nelson at White Lake and later moved onto a farm near Bovee.
To this union were born 8 children. Her husband and six children preceded her in death. They are Ida (Mrs. Con Olson), Adolph, Martin, Oscar, Myrtle, and Annie. She leaves to mourn her daughter, Dora Johnson, of Kadoka, her son, Arthur, of Beverly Hills, Calif., and 27 grandchildren and six great grandchildren besides many friends. her sister, Mrs. Iver Arnsten, died 2 years ago.
